Abstract

The utility model belongs to the technical field of cylinders, in particular to a high-airtightness cylinder convenient to adjust, which comprises a bottom plate, a mounting plate and a vertical plate, wherein an adjusting groove is arranged in the bottom plate, an adjusting block is arranged in the adjusting groove, a mounting hole is formed in the mounting plate, an adjusting mechanism is arranged on the left side of the bottom plate, a rotary cylinder is connected on the right side of the vertical plate, the vertical plate is positioned above the bottom plate, a rotary disc is connected on the left side of the vertical plate, a side plate is arranged on the left side of the rotary disc, a shell is arranged in the side plate, a sealing ring is arranged above a piston, an oil seal is arranged above the sealing ring, and a connecting block is arranged above the oil seal; the utility model discloses a be provided with revolving cylinder, can drive the carousel through revolving cylinder and rotate, the carousel drives the shell on the curb plate and carries out the regulation on the angle, makes the cylinder can carry out the regulation on the angle according to the condition, has promoted the flexibility of cylinder structure.

Technical Field
The utility model relates to a cylinder technical field specifically is a convenient high gas tightness cylinder of adjusting.
Background
The cylinder refers to a cylindrical metal part guiding a piston to perform linear reciprocating motion in the cylinder, air converts thermal energy into mechanical energy through expansion in an engine cylinder, and gas is compressed by the piston in a compressor cylinder to increase pressure.
However, the cylinder in the prior art is inconvenient to mount and fix, cannot be adjusted in angle and has an inflexible structure.
Therefore, a high-airtightness air cylinder convenient to adjust is provided for solving the problems.

The utility model discloses an useful part lies in:
1. the mounting plate can be fixed on a proper plane through the mounting holes on the mounting plate and a proper fixing piece, so that the cylinder can be conveniently mounted and fixed, when the cylinder is not required to be fixed, the mounting plate can be put into the bottom plate through the sliding of the adjusting block in the adjusting groove, and a user can conveniently store and store the cylinder;
2. the utility model discloses a be provided with revolving cylinder, can drive the carousel through revolving cylinder and rotate, the carousel drives the shell on the curb plate and carries out the regulation on the angle, makes the cylinder can carry out the regulation on the angle according to the condition, has promoted the flexibility of cylinder structure;
3. the utility model discloses a be provided with adjustment mechanism, make the fixed block can slide on the connecting rod through slide and slider, the fixed block can drive the bottom plate and carry out the translation to make the bottom plate can adjust according to the size of shell, further promotion cylinder structure's flexibility, make bottom plate and riser can pull down and fix the shell of difference.
